摘要: 一.前言多条件查询分页以及排序 每个系统里都会有这个的代码 做好这块 可以大大提高开发效率 所以博主分享下自己的6个版本的 多条件查询分页以及排序二.目前状况 不论是ado.net 还是EF 在做多条件搜索时 都有这类似的代码这样有几个不好的地方1.当增加查询条件,需要改代码,对应去写相应的代码。2.对多表查询以及or的支持 不是很好。而我们很常见的需求不可能是一个表的查询3. 这样写表示层直接出现 了SQL语句 或者 linq 的拉姆达表达式 这是很不好的 表示层不应该知道数据访问技术4.有的时候 我们的业务逻辑层接口是这样的 IList<***> seach(string na 阅读全文
posted @ 2013-04-03 02:44 derryliang 阅读(217) 评论(0) 推荐(0)